In house structures, bed insects can relocate from one home to an additional up and down and horizontally. Long-distance problems take place when plagued items such as bedding, furnishings, or packaging products are transferred to new areas. Also, travelers can carry bed insects back and forth in clothes, baggage, and laptop or tablet computer instances.

Bed pest surveillance is vital to estimate the infestation level prior to control and the treatment efficiency after control. The adhering to are types of bed bug monitoring techniques.


Assessors should look for reddish-black areas, eggs, dropped "skin" of larval bed insects, and immature and grown-up bed insects in their habitat near human relaxing locations such as beds, sofas, and recliner chairs (see Number 5). Furthermore, the pleasant and mildewy smell produced by bed bug waste is characteristic of a modest to high degree of problem.

Picture: Garo Goodrow, Penn State Bed pest smelling dogs can spot bed pests with a 97 percent rate of precision. They can find all bed pest life stages in low and high problems.


When pet dogs discover bed pop over to this site pest smells, they inform their trainer that validates by aesthetic inspection. Dogs are extra effective than people because pets spot bed bugs in locations without sight such as within wall surfaces, behind baseboards, and in furnishings. Interceptor cups, which have a discovery rate of 89 percent, are the most typical devices.


Number 6: Interceptor mugs utilized to trap bed pests. Image: Parker Goodrow, pal of Penn State In addition, interceptor mugs are also used to review therapy efficacy and to secure beds from bed bugs.




Number 8: Digital tracking devices used to draw in and trap bed bugs. Photo: David P. James, Flickr (used with consent) When both aesthetic inspection and interceptors are made use of for monitoring bed insects, the detection rate increases to 99 percent.

To avoid this, travelers need to check behind headboards, under sheets, and in bed mattress seams and tufts at places where they stay. Likewise, they should examine their travel luggage prior to carrying it back into their homes and wash and dry all clothes with warm water and warm air quickly upon return. If furnishings is thrown out as a result of bed bugs infestation, render it unusable prior to positioning in a dumpster or land fill to make sure that someone does not unknowingly bring infested things home.


Mechanical control is not poisonous, is green, and does not need a re-entry period (time that have to pass in between the pesticide application and the time that people can go back to that area without safety garments and devices). However, mechanical control does not have a recurring impact so re-infestation of bed bugs can happen (Pest Control Houston Bed Bugs A1).


As an option, clothes dryers alone can eliminate bed pests when utilized at click this link a heat for 15 to 30 minutes. Temperature levels of 131 F or above are lethal to all bed bug phases. Laundering in cold look here water and drying out at lower temperature levels might not eliminate bed insects. Vacuuming can be used to eliminate nymphs, lost "skins," and dead bed insects.


Vacuum cleaner completely everyday and reach all feasible areas (top, base, and sides) of the items vacuumed. Empty the hoover promptly. If the vacuum has a bag, confine it in a plastic bag and seal it prior to discarding. Vapor treatment can be used on things that can not be treated with pesticides, such as sofas, recliner chairs, beds, playthings, and so on.
